Nimbin Building Designer — Fixed-Price Design & Lismore City Council Approval Management

Nimbin draws people who have made a deliberate choice about how they want to live — connected to the land, embedded in community, and far enough from the mainstream to do things differently. Building here reflects those values, and the planning environment reflects them too. Development applications for Nimbin and the surrounding rural hinterland are assessed by Lismore City Council under the Lismore LEP 2012, with Nimbin's own dedicated DCP chapter setting the planning framework for the village itself. Water supply constraints, koala habitat corridors, bushfire-prone ridgelines, steep terrain, and a council actively focused on protecting Nimbin's character all shape what gets approved. Frequently asked questions for
Homeowners in Nimbin

Nimbin sits within the Lismore City Council Local Government Area, so all development applications — whether in the village or on surrounding rural land — are assessed by Lismore City Council under the Lismore LEP 2012 and the Lismore DCP. Nimbin has its own dedicated chapter within the DCP that sets specific planning controls for the village, covering the residential precinct, commercial core, and surrounding areas. We’re familiar with both the general Lismore framework and Nimbin’s specific provisions, and structure DA applications accordingly.

Yes. Lismore City Council’s DCP includes a dedicated Nimbin Village chapter that identifies different precincts within the village and provides specific planning controls and guidelines for each — covering built form, land use, character, and environmental sustainability. The residential precinct has its own controls around building scale, materials, and design that reflect the character of the existing village. These controls exist specifically to protect what makes Nimbin, Nimbin — and we design within them rather than around them.

It can. The potable water supply serving Nimbin village has finite capacity, and Lismore City Council factors this into its assessment of new development. For projects that increase water demand — new dwellings, dual occupancies, or secondary dwellings within the village boundary — demonstrating adequate water supply is part of the DA process. We assess this at feasibility stage and structure the application to address it properly.

Not always. Under the Lismore LEP, rural allotments generally need to meet minimum lot size thresholds to carry a dwelling entitlement — typically 40 hectares or 20 hectares in some areas. Many smaller rural lots around Nimbin do have entitlements due to historical planning controls, but many don’t. Checking your lot’s entitlement status is one of the first things we do in a feasibility assessment — because it determines whether a dwelling application is possible at all before any design work begins.

It depends on whether your site is in the village or on surrounding rural land. Village residential DAs typically require a Statement of Environmental Effects and BASIX certificate at minimum. Rural lots commonly also require a bushfire assessment, on-site effluent disposal design, biodiversity assessment, arborist report, and detailed survey. We coordinate all required reports through our established network of specialists — so nothing is missing at lodgement.
